The New York City Police Department is asking for the public’s assistance identifying the individuals, depicted in the attached surveillance photographs, who are wanted for questioning in connection to an assault, that occurred within the confines of the 44th Precinct in the Bronx.

The following was reported to police.

On Tuesday, November 10, 2020, at approximately 1022 hours, on the corner of Jerome Avenue and E. 174th Street, three unidentified male individuals approached a 19-year-old male victim as he was walking. The victim observed the individuals holding knives and attempted to run away. When they reached E. 174th Street and Townsend Avenue, the individuals proceeded to stab him throughout the body and then fled, on foot, northbound on E. 174th Street.

The victim sustained injuries to his left flank, abdomen, right arm and right leg. He was transported by EMS to SBH Health System, St. Barnabas, in stable condition.

The first individual is described as a light-skinned adult male, approximately 18-25 years of age, 5’6″ tall, 150 lbs. and was last seen wearing a red sweatshirt, light colored pants and black sneakers.

The second individual is described as a light-skinned adult male, approximately 18-25 years of age, 5’9″ tall, 170 lbs. and was last seen wearing a black sweatshirt and blue jeans.

The third individual is described as a light-skinned adult male, approximately 18-25 years of age, 5’6″ tall, 150 lbs. and was last seen wearing a brown jacket, blue jeans and dark colored boots.
